今天聊一聊虛擬化技術(shù)(虛擬化技術(shù)介紹)
虛擬化技術(shù)(Virtualization)是當(dāng)今計算機(jī)科學(xué)領(lǐng)域中一項(xiàng)重要的技術(shù),它在信息技術(shù)和云計算領(lǐng)域發(fā)揮著關(guān)鍵作用。在本文中,我將向你解釋什么是虛擬化技術(shù)以及它在計算機(jī)系統(tǒng)中的應(yīng)用。
簡單來說,虛擬化技術(shù)是通過軟件或硬件創(chuàng)建虛擬(而非實(shí)際的)資源的過程。這些虛擬資源可以包括服務(wù)器、存儲設(shè)備、網(wǎng)絡(luò)和操作系統(tǒng)等。通過虛擬化技術(shù),我們可以將一個物理資源劃分為多個邏輯上獨(dú)立的虛擬實(shí)例,從而提供更高效、可擴(kuò)展和靈活的計算環(huán)境。
虛擬化技術(shù)有多種形式,其中最常見的是服務(wù)器虛擬化。在傳統(tǒng)的服務(wù)器架構(gòu)中,每個服務(wù)器通常只運(yùn)行一個操作系統(tǒng)和應(yīng)用程序。這導(dǎo)致了服務(wù)器資源的低效利用和物理設(shè)備的浪費(fèi)。通過服務(wù)器虛擬化,我們可以在一臺物理服務(wù)器上同時運(yùn)行多個虛擬機(jī),每個虛擬機(jī)都具有自己的操作系統(tǒng)和應(yīng)用程序。這使得服務(wù)器資源得到充分利用,減少了硬件成本,提高了服務(wù)器的靈活性和可管理性。
另一個常見的虛擬化形式是存儲虛擬化。在傳統(tǒng)的存儲架構(gòu)中,每個服務(wù)器通常連接到一個獨(dú)立的物理存儲設(shè)備。這導(dǎo)致了存儲資源的碎片化和難以管理。通過存儲虛擬化,我們可以將多個物理存儲設(shè)備抽象為一個統(tǒng)一的虛擬存儲池。這使得存儲資源可以按需分配給各個服務(wù)器,提高了存儲資源的利用率,并簡化了存儲管理的復(fù)雜性。
此外,虛擬化技術(shù)還可以應(yīng)用于網(wǎng)絡(luò)虛擬化、桌面虛擬化和應(yīng)用程序虛擬化等領(lǐng)域。網(wǎng)絡(luò)虛擬化可以將物理網(wǎng)絡(luò)劃分為多個邏輯上獨(dú)立的虛擬網(wǎng)絡(luò),從而實(shí)現(xiàn)更靈活的網(wǎng)絡(luò)配置和管理。桌面虛擬化允許用戶在一臺物理計算機(jī)上運(yùn)行多個虛擬桌面,提供個人化的工作環(huán)境和集中管理的優(yōu)勢。應(yīng)用程序虛擬化則將應(yīng)用程序與底層操作系統(tǒng)解耦,使得應(yīng)用程序能夠在不同的操作系統(tǒng)上運(yùn)行,提高了應(yīng)用程序的可移植性和兼容性。
虛擬化技術(shù)帶來了許多重要的好處。首先,它可以提高計算資源的利用率。通過將物理資源虛擬化為多個虛擬實(shí)例,我們可以更充分地利用硬件資源,降低成本和能源消耗。
其次,虛擬化技術(shù)提供了更高的靈活性和可擴(kuò)展性。通過虛擬化,我們可以根據(jù)需求快速創(chuàng)建、部署和調(diào)整虛擬機(jī)或虛擬資源,而無需進(jìn)行復(fù)雜的物理設(shè)備遷移或重新配置。
此外,虛擬化技術(shù)還增強(qiáng)了系統(tǒng)的可靠性和安全性。通過隔離不同的虛擬環(huán)境,一臺虛擬機(jī)上的問題不會影響其他虛擬機(jī)的運(yùn)行。這提供了更好的容錯能力,即使某個虛擬機(jī)發(fā)生故障或遭受攻擊,其他虛擬機(jī)仍然可以正常運(yùn)行。
總結(jié)起來,虛擬化技術(shù)通過創(chuàng)建虛擬資源,提供了更高的資源利用率、靈活性和可擴(kuò)展性。通過深入理解和合理應(yīng)用虛擬化技術(shù),我們可以構(gòu)建更靈活、高效和安全的計算環(huán)境。